K913749 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the EDENTRACE AIRFLOW 3171/SLEEP LAB AIRFLOW 3170. Classified as Monitor, Breathing Frequency (product code BZQ),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Edentec Corp. (Eden Prairie,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on July 2, 1992 after a review of 316 days - an unusually long review period, suggesting complex equivalence evaluation.

This device falls under the Anesthesiology F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 868.2375 - the FDA anesthesiology and respiratory device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
